The Tonga–Kermadec Arc is a major submarine volcanic island arc and trench system in the southwest Pacific Ocean, formed by the subduction of the Pacific Plate beneath the Indo-Australian Plate and known for its intense seismic and volcanic activity.

The Tonga-Kermadec subduction system is a major convergent plate boundary in the southwest Pacific where the Pacific Plate descends beneath the Indo-Australian Plate, producing one of the world’s deepest ocean trenches and most active seismic and volcanic regions.
